Notice how the two outer fingers would also hit the base of the mortise.That’s why you need those secondary mortises—to provide clearance for the back edges of those fingers.

If they’re a hair too long, it’s no big deal, because the hinges cover them.And now the fingers on the backs of the hinges don’t contact any wood as the hinges open.When the lid is closed, the clearance gaps are visible.
